Spike Chunsoft has released new details about their upcoming detective story Ai: The Somnium Files.

Psychic detective Kaname, the player character, must dive into the dreams of others in order to solve real world mysteries. Mental blocks are puzzles that obscure the truth, and any action Kaname takes while exploring dreams will draw down a six minute time limit.

Whipseey, the debut commercial release from developer Daniel Ramirez, has been scheduled for release in Q3 (July - September) by publisher Blowfish Studios. The 2D platformer stars the titular Whipseey, who uses a whip on their head to attack enemies, swing from points in the environment, and even extend jumps by twirling it like a helicopter.

This month's NES Online update includes the ability to be just a little godlike.

In addition to the previously announced updates, today's update added a SP version to Kid Icarus. The special version provides the game's Three Sacred Treasures - Wings of Pegasus, Arrow of Light, and Mirror Shield - and starts out in the final stretch before Medusa.

VA-11 HALL-A, the PC and PlayStation Vita visual novel centered around the life of a futuristic bartender, will release on Switch May 2. Set largely in the titular bar, the player has to maintain a standard of living and experience the story of the bar's many unique patrons.

The Tetris 99 Cup will return this weekend, with more opportunities to bring home the (999) gold (coins).

Running from Friday at 9 a.m. EDT to 2:59 a.m. Monday morning, the tournament will award 999 My Nintendo Gold Coins ($9.99) for top players. The second competition will institute a points system based on finishes during the play time, with 100 points being equivalent to a win, and the top 999 scorers receiving the money.

Hellblade: Senua's Sacrifice has been tabbed for an April 11 release according to the website of developers Ninja Theory. It was originally released in 2017, and tabbed for a Switch version in February's Nintendo Direct.

The Unreal Engine 4 powered title is being ported to the Switch by British firm QLOC, who previously handled the remastered Dark Souls.

Nintendo held the US finals for their Smash and Splatoon 2 tournaments today, and the champions will be advancing to pre-E3 weekend.

The 2019 World Championships for Splatoon 2 and Super Smash Bros Ultimate will be held in Los Angeles on June 8. The US champions will face teams from Europe, Australia and Japan in 4v4 Splatoon 2 and 3v3 Squad Strike play for Super Smash Bros Ultimate.
